All things considered, this study offers insightful information about the nutritional variations
between non-organic and organic bananas. The study highlights the little but noteworthy
benefits of selecting organic produce, namely in terms of mineral content and antioxidant
activity, for bananas. It also highlights the wider effects of organic agricultural methods on
environmental sustainability and human health.
